Output e6caf409f86fce97d675aeedc31b632f64111bb974e1dc532b387bda505814db:8

value
1405858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7038329c6b10b89cf335a7d9e7fa895d11f687ed OP_EQUALVERIFY OP_CHECKSIG
address
1BEN1AqYvz54ZhsXWJBvCs1UvCKBQ7MEfK
transaction
e6caf409f86fce97d675aeedc31b632f64111bb974e1dc532b387bda505814db
confirmations
553284
spent
true